While gifting a parrot can bring happiness, several elements must be dealt with to ensure that both the bird and the recipient are well-prepared for this new adventure.
1. Commitment
Parrots require a significant amount of time and attention. Are the possible owners all set for this dedication? The life-span of some types can vary from 10 to 60 years, depending on the species.
2. Area and Environment
Before gifting a parrot, it's crucial to examine whether the recipient has the proper space for the bird. Parrots require a well-ventilated and safe environment, along with adequate room to work out and play.
3. Diet and Care
Parrots have particular dietary requirements that need to be met for their health and well-being. A well balanced diet plan primarily includes seeds, fresh fruits, and veggies. It's necessary for the recipient to comprehend how to offer these needs.
4. Interaction
Parrots thrive on social interaction. If the recipient is regularly away from home or has a hectic lifestyle, a parrot might not be the very best choice for an animal.
5. Allergies
Before gifting a parrot, it's essential to ensure that no one in the family has allergies to plumes or dander.
6. Financial Responsibility
Owning a parrot comes with monetary obligations. Expenses can consist of food, toys, veterinary care, and an appropriate cage. The potential owner must have a mutual understanding of these continuous costs.
Preparing for the Gift
When the decision to gift a parrot is made, the following actions can assist ensure a smooth transition for the new pet:
1. Research study
Motivate the recipient to research the specific parrot types in detail. Comprehending its requirements, personality, and care will foster a much better relationship.
2. Purchase
Think about connecting to trustworthy breeders or family pet stores that prioritize the wellness of their animals. Adoption from rescue organizations is also a great option.
3. Materials
Collect the needed materials before the parrot shows up:
Cage: A large, safe cage suitable for the selected types.Food: High-quality p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ables.Toys: Enrichment toys to keep the parrot engaged.Perches: Different-sized perches for foot health.4. Preliminary Setup
Establish the cage and environment before introducing the parrot. Guarantee that the area is safe and devoid of dangers.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: Can I present a parrot to a child?
A: While kids can take pleasure in having a parrot, it's vital that an adult takes primary responsibility for its care. Parrots require adult supervision, and some species can be rather demanding.
Q2: Are parrots great for first-time pet owners?
A: Some smaller sized species like Budgerigars or Cockatiels appropriate for first-time animal owners due to the fact that they are much easier to take care of. Nevertheless, larger species can be more difficult and are much better matched for skilled owners.
Q3: How can I make sure a parrot has a pleased life?
A: Ensure that the parrot gets regular interaction, a balanced diet plan, a roomy living environment, and lots of stimulation through toys and social engagement.
Q4: Is it all right to keep a parrot in a little cage?

Q5: Do parrots require companionship?
A: Yes, parrots are social animals and can become lonesome. If the owner is regularly away from home, it might be worth thinking about embracing more than one parrot.
